Output 5ff7864144fc8d4e77d65b229c2eceb676428fa0391f4124a845d34a5ea7f4cf:0

value
8037946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ff556a2e1df003c071d138739a9b8456f85e08 OP_EQUAL
address
32EjBPvV6DVrK3xiXr2uKnXAE1LU5Z6ypR
transaction
5ff7864144fc8d4e77d65b229c2eceb676428fa0391f4124a845d34a5ea7f4cf
confirmations
504908
spent
true